Two Solo Projects by Artists:
Prasanta Sahu and Ushmita Sahu(Hyderabad)

Palak Dubey

Works by PrasantaSahu, titled, ‘Blueprint of City’ and UshmitaSahu’s titled,’White Noise’ were recently on display at Kalakriti Art Gallery, Hyderabad from 1st July to 15th July. Both the artist’s works promised a spectacular journey to the viewers,though in completely diverse directions. While the works byPrasanta explore the surroundings and their many interrelated paradigms. The works by Ushmita are highly introspective in nature and are a like a visual process that excavates an unknown land.The expanses that exemplify her intimate rendezvous with the ‘self ’, spread wide open, straight forwardand bare in front of the viewer.

Prasanta’s works traverse through the ever evolving urban terrain seeping deep into thin fissures, absorbing and registering the intricate details. His works give the welldeserved importance to the group of people who imbibe into themselves the strength and spirit to design the infrastructure, they are present in all directions of the society in the form of construction site workers, small food stall owners, and others.
